Commercial building for sale in Great Falls, MT: flex office and shop space with C-5 zoning and a 12 foot garage door. This is a great opportunity to own shop and office space in one of Montana's growing commercial corridors, with immediate income producing use today and a low cost path to a large open shop tomorrow. The building is currently configured with 4 private offices and multiple dedicated storage areas, move in ready for administrative, professional, financial, or general services use, all permitted by right under Great Falls C-5 zoning, meaning no conditional use hearing required. Above the finished drop ceilings sits the real upside: exposed metal roof trusses and a 12 foot garage door, both concealed behind ceilings that were lowered years ago for cost efficiency. Removing the false ceiling and select interior walls opens the building into one large, clear span shop, ideal for light manufacturing, an artisan shop, vehicle repair and service, general repair, or contractor adjacent operations, all uses permitted by right in this C-5 zone. Great Falls C-5 zoning allows a wide range of by right, administrative review only uses relevant to this property, including general services, professional services, administrative and financial services, general repair, vehicle repair, vehicle sales and service, light manufacturing and assembly, artisan shop, climate controlled indoor storage, general sales, restaurant, health care clinic and services, and instructional or commercial education facility. That flexibility means a buyer is not locked into office use. The building can pivot to a shop, service center, light manufacturing space, or retail showroom without the delay of a conditional use process. Own both office and shop space under one roof in a growing city with room to expand. Keep it as is for immediate office and service use, or invest in opening the ceilings to unlock a large format shop behind that 12 foot garage door. Built in 1895 and commanding the same stretch of North Main Street for over 130 years, the Stockman Building is one of Livingston's most recognizable and enduring landmarks — a two-story brick cornerstone with a basement that has witnessed the full arc of this remarkable western town. Step inside and the character is immediate. A sweeping curved wooden bar anchors the main level, its warm honey-toned wood and arched back bar mirror the centerpiece of a room that took generations to earn its patina. Full-length exposed brick walls lined with original timber posts run the length of the dining room — the kind of authentic interior atmosphere that simply cannot be replicated in new construction and that draws people in before they ever see a menu. At 6,250 square feet the building offers a fully operational main level restaurant and bar space with basement storage, and three updated upper-level apartments on the second floor — two one-bedroom units and one two-bedroom unit — all with generous windows and shared laundry. The Stockman Building sits prominently within Livingston's Downtown Commercial Historic District, listed on the National Register of Historic Places — a designation that reflects both the building's architectural integrity and its irreplaceable role in the cultural fabric of one of Montana's most storied communities. Flanked by thriving neighboring businesses and steps from the Yellowstone River, the Murray Hotel, and the best of downtown Livingston, the location is as strong as the bones.
